Two identical capacitors have same capacitance $C$. One of them is charged to the potential $V$ and other to the potential $2 \mathrm{~V}$. The negative ends of both are connected together. When the positive ends are also joined together, the decrease in energy of the combined system is :

A parallel plate capacitor of capacitance $$2 \mathrm{~F}$$ is charged to a potential $$\mathrm{V}$$, The energy stored in the capacitor is $$E_{1}$$. The capacitor is now connected to another uncharged identical capacitor in parallel combination. The energy stored in the combination is $$\mathrm{E}_{2}$$. The ratio $$\mathrm{E}_{2} / \mathrm{E}_{1}$$ is :
